The role of forests in energy and climate change - integrating objectives

Abstract

Woody biomass utilization presents a tremendous opportunity to address energy independence directly through the use of domestic wood as an energy source that offsets fossil fuel. It also works indirectly through conservation by the substitution of wood for higher embodied energy construction materials such as concrete and steel. Both the direct and indirect measures mitigate climate change by reducing greenhouse gas emissions. By integrating these goals with treatments of forests to make them more resilient to disturbances, longer term C sequestration is accomplished in the live forest on the landscape. This paper explores future and current technologies that are available to accomplish utilization and sustainable treatments in the field.
